Oil Wearmetal Analysis by X-Ray (OWAX).

Abstract

A detailed feasibility study has been completed for application of the technique of x-ray fluorescence spectrometry to the analysis of wear metals in aircraft engine lubricants. Through laboratory experimentation, the relative values of various excitation methods, sample treatments, and sensor systems have been established. The recommended approach is based upon the modification of an existing portable x-ray analyzer to include a high-intensity x-ray excitation source, sample filtration, and a small computer for data analysis, display, and storage.
